Assessment 1
You must have one year of general experience which includes progressively responsible clerical, office, or other work that indicates ability to acquire the particular knowledge and skills needed to perform the duties of the position to be filled.
OR
2 years of education above high school.
OR
Combination of general experience and education.

2. This position requires candidates to pass a physical abilities test designed to measure candidates ability to perform the physical requirements of the job. The test requires carrying 30-50 pound boxes like those found on the job. It also requires bending, squatting, and walking to reach the boxes in addition to climbing and balancing on a pulpit ladder up to 15 feet high. Can you perform these physical requirements?
